The Collector, also known as Taneleer Tivan, is an Elder of the universe and has lived an incredibly long life, making him highly resilient to damage, but he can be killed if destroyed on a molecular level. The Collector’s remarkable abilities and powers, including immortality and cosmic energy manipulation, make him a unique and fascinating character in the Marvel Comics universe.
Introduction to the Collector
The Collector is a powerful being with a range of abilities, including shapeshifting, superhuman strength, and energy manipulation, which make him a formidable opponent in the Marvel universe. His immortality and regenerative abilities also make him highly resistant to damage, but not invulnerable to death.
The Collector’s Powers and Abilities
The Collector’s powers are derived from his cosmic energy, which allows him to manipulate reality and bend the laws of physics. His immortality is also a key aspect of his character, making him one of the most long-lived beings in the Marvel universe.
